The Multilateral Convention to Implement Tax Treaty Related Measures to Prevent Base Erosion and Profit Shifting (the Convention) is one of the outcomes of the OECD/G20 Project to tackle base erosion and profit shifting (the BEPS Project) i.e. tax planning strategies that exploit gaps and mismatches in tax rules to artificially shift profits to low or no-tax locations where there is little or no economic activity, resulting in little or no overall corporate tax being paid. The BEPS Action Plan was developed by the OECD Committee on Fiscal Affairs (CFA) and endorsed by the G20 Leaders in September 2013. It identified 15 actions to address base erosion and profit shifting (BEPS) in a comprehensive manner, and set out deadlines to implement those actions. Action 15 of the BEPS Action Plan provided for an analysis of the possible development of a multilateral instrument to implement tax treaty related BEPS measures "to enable jurisdictions that wish to do so to implement measures developed in the course of the work on BEPS and amend bilateral tax treaties". The Action 15 Report, "Developing a Multilateral Instrument to Modify Bilateral Tax Treaties", concluded that a multilateral instrument, providing an innovative approach to enable countries to swiftly modify their bilateral tax treaties to implement measures developed in the course of the work on BEPS, is desirable and feasible, and that negotiations for such an instrument should be convened quickly.

More than 100 jurisdictions have concluded negotiations on a multilateral instrument (MLI) that will swiftly implement a series of tax treaty measures to update international tax rules and lessen the opportunity for tax avoidance by multinational enterprises. The new instrument will transpose results from the OECD/G20 Base Erosion and Profit Shifting (BEPS) Project into more than 2000 tax treaties worldwide. A signing ceremony will be held in June 2017 in Paris.

The final version of the OECD Multilateral Convention to Implement Tax Treaty Related Measures to Prevent Base Erosion and Profit Shifting (MLI) was published at the end of November 2016, and the signing ceremony took place in Paris on 7 June 2017, during which 67 countries covering 68 jurisdictions signed the instrument. Cameroon and Mauritius joined the initial signatories on early July 2017. In this article, the authors provide a general description of the MLI, discuss the step plan to analyse whether a given tax treaty provision will be impacted by the instrument and offer some personal concluding remarks.
